Silverfish in DFW Homes: What Draws Them and How to Stop Them
Silverfish are the small, teardrop-shaped insects that dart out of bathroom cabinets and bookshelves in North Texas homes. They thrive on humidity and starches, which is why Dallas-Fort Worth bathrooms, laundry rooms, and stored-box areas are their favorite harborage.
What draws them in
Silverfish follow moisture. Leaky under-sink plumbing, poor bathroom ventilation, and cardboard stored in a warm garage all create the damp, starch-rich conditions they need.
How to keep them out
Lower indoor humidity, fix plumbing drips, swap cardboard storage for sealed plastic bins, and vacuum baseboards and closet corners. Persistent activity across multiple rooms usually means the source is a hidden moisture problem a local provider can help pinpoint.
